Transaction 86e7da93f0cbfdaa43a4901605d6a9c7007e82a7335ff68021687ad2d5e65100
1 Input
1 Output
-
86e7da93f0cbfdaa43a4901605d6a9c7007e82a7335ff68021687ad2d5e65100:0
- value
- 1968476
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c21ce3abb916b1a3e53e10105eb2c71f2260183c OP_EQUAL
- address
- 3KPPd2RS7TFQc7LGm1xpE8kiVASV8qjNo3